PEORIA DRAWINGS

A milestone in Crumb's career was The American Scene exhibit at Lakeview Center, Peoria, Illinois May 17 - June 25, 1967. Of the 36 drawings listed in the catalog/flyer only about 16 have been reproduced in print or on the web. All drawings signed R. Crumb '66.

Sources:

Promethean Enterprises 1 (1969) & 2 (1970) [PE1,PE2], The Complete Crumb 4 (1989), Alexander Gallery exhibition catalog (1993) [AG], "Yeah, But is it Art?" exhibition catalog [YBIIA] and various web sites

The 36 drawings listed in the program:

    1 - Gossip, 2 - Mother and Child, 3 - Going Downtown on the Streetcar, 4 - Oops, 5 - The El, 6 - The Flats, 7 - Times Square, 8 - Avenue D, 9 - Boobtoob, 10 - High School Girl with Cello, 11 - Judy Galloway, 12 - Junior, 13 - Watusi, 14 - I Feel so Good, 15 - Seeburg Jukebox, 16 - Do the Pony, 17 - Teenybop, 18 - Wandering Minstrel, 19 - Railroad Bill, 20 - Rock 'n' Roll, 21 - Silver 8 Streak 1, 22 - 1951 Nash, 23 - 48 Pontiac, 24 - Dragster 1, 25 - Dragster 2, 26 - Dodge, 27 - Silver 8 Streak 2, 28 - Lunch, 29 - Dana, 30 - Good Housekeeping, 31 - Follow the Leader, 32 - Crash, 33 - Orange Bowl '67, 34 - Power Shovel on Sunday, 35 - Steam Shovel, 36 - The Old Place
